Job Title: Clinical Coordinator
Job Type: Exempt, Full Time
Lifepoint Rehabilitation is part of Lifepoint Health, a diversified healthcare delivery network with facilities coast to coast. We are driven by a profound commitment to prioritise your well‑being so you can provide exceptional care to others and to making communities healthier.
How You'll Contribute- Coordinates staff scheduling, educational/development activities and performance evaluations.
- Collaborates with physicians, nursing, pharmacy and other healthcare team members/ departments to determine, coordinate, and provide medical nutrition therapy.
- Identifies and resolves issues affecting the delivery of clinical services.
- During tour of duty, maintains constant communication between all nursing areas and the registration area in order to facilitate a smooth throughput of patients.
- Provides basic direct patient care as needed.
- Insertion of PICC lines when ordered by the physician.
- Accesses Hickman catheters and port‑a‑cath lines when needed.
- Responds to all in‑hospital emergencies to guide and assure appropriate outcomes.
- Treats patients and their families with respect and dignity.
- During tour of duty, rounds on all post‑surgical or procedural patients.
- Provides 'just in time' education for staff during tour of duty.
- Assists physicians with procedures.
- Reports all incidents or unusual events to their Director or appropriate supervisor.
- Provides moderate sedation when required. Knowledgeable of policy and procedures.
